The DoE’s Philippine Energy Plan 2024-40 forecasts that energy demand will rise fourfold during this period, representing annual growth of about 5% and requiring 43,736 MW of additional power generation capacity. The National Grid Corporation of the Philippines (NGCP) now manages, operates and maintains the Government’s transmission facilities and shall be responsible for making the necessary grid impact studies for possible nuclear plants in the future.

Webb19 juni 2024 · QUEZON CITY, Philippines —The Department of Energy (DOE) on Thursday warned that the power supply in Luzon may fall under yellow and red alerts from June to August due to the shutdown of several baseload coal and gas power plants.
